Job Summary

Prepare materials or merchandise for assembly line production by reading provided tickets that identify materials needed; gather prescribed materials from stock using forklifts, hand trucks, and rolling carts. You will be responsible for assembling wood products, including interior and exterior doors, ensuring each piece meets quality standards and specifications. This role involves hands-on construction of millwork items using hand and power tools commonly used in woodworking.

Duties And Responsibilities

  • Assemble various millwork products such as exterior and interior door units, wooden patios, Dutch doors, casing, and window units by reading orders.
  • Identify necessary modifications; operate machinery that modifies the product; prepare the product for shipment by applying casing, sleeves, stickers, etc.
  • Inspect the overall quality of the assembled product throughout the assembly process.
  • Repair and/or disassemble defective millwork to prepare it for resale or restock.
  • Maintain a clear production area free of debris; properly store and secure work materials, hardware, tools, and equipment.
  • Attend all safety trainings and meetings; comply with OSHA and agency safety policies.
  • Perform routine maintenance on all tools used including: cleaning, oiling, checking to ensure proper functioning, calibrating machines, checking measuring tool accuracy, and notifying a supervisor of larger repairs or malfunctions.
  • Willing and able to be cross-trained to handle all stations along the line.

Requirements

  • High School diploma or equivalent
  • 1-2 years' related experience and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ience
  • Experience using common hand and power tools such as saws, drills, hammers, screwdrivers, and nail guns—especially in woodworking or door assembly
  • Ability to operate warehouse equipment such as forklifts, chop saws, door machines, and drills
  • Ability to frequently lift and/or move 75–100 pounds
